Fujifilm Z37 vs Panasonic TS30 Physical Comparison
If you're going to carry around your camera regularly, you'll need to factor in its weight and proportions. The Fujifilm Z37 offers outside measurements of 90mm x 58mm x 24mm (3.5" x 2.3" x 0.9") having a weight of 125 grams (0.28 lbs) whilst the Panasonic TS30 has measurements of 104mm x 58mm x 20mm (4.1" x 2.3" x 0.8") accompanied by a weight of 142 grams (0.31 lbs).

Fujifilm Z37 vs Panasonic TS30 Sensor Comparison
Sometimes, its tough to visualise the gap in sensor sizes only by researching specs. The image below should offer you a more clear sense of the sensor measurements in the Fujifilm Z37 and TS30.
All in all, both of those cameras offer the same exact sensor sizing but not the same resolution. You should anticipate the Panasonic TS30 to result in more detail using its extra 6 Megapixels. Greater resolution can also allow you to crop photos a little more aggressively. The more aged Fujifilm Z37 will be disadvantaged when it comes to sensor innovation.
